Up for sale is my 1987 Mercedes 300D. This is one of the cleanest and most mechanically sound 87 300D's you will find in the northern states. This car has seen very little snow in its entire life. I bought this from another diesel Mercedes Lover who purchased the car in Florida, where it spent most of its life up until the last few years. This classic Mercedes has been used as a daily driver for the last 12 months, while recieveing exceptional care and maintenance. In those 12 months I put about 14,000miles on it, and never had any major problems. I’m a big advocate of preventative maintenance, so any issues are always addressed before they become problems. It just went from here in Ohio to Indian Beach, North Carolina in July without any issues and averaged 28-30mpg with the car loaded down. My daily commute is 30-40 min one way and I track my fuel economy with the best being 31.5mpg and the worst being 28.4mpg. Before I started this job, the 300D was mainly used in town and averaged 22-24mpg all in town miles. The car drives beautifully on the highway and will pull 80mph easily. The suspension is very tight and as you will see in the list below, it is pretty much all new. It does have a slight pull to the right, and will eventually need a Mercedes Benz alignment; however she has had this pull for at least 5000miles with no issues, and no wear on the tires at all. The transmission has good shift points, and pulls stongly, but shifts too firmly at times. The hvac system works very well, the a/c will freeze you out, and the heater works well. All buttons work correctly moving the air to where it is supposed to be. Even the rear headrest still flip down.
